Immigrant Services ESL Intern

Posted on: April 16, 2013

Posted by: Refugee and Immigrant Community Services, Heartland Human Care Services Inc.

Description

Heartland Alliance for Human Needs & Human Rights helps people living in poverty or in danger to improve their lives and realize their human rights. For more than 120 years, Heartland Alliance has provided hope, opportunity, and solutions--through both services and advocacy. Our work spans across four key areas [housing, health care, legal protections, and economic opportunity], creating paths from crisis to stability and on to success.

Heartland Human Care Services' (HHCS) Refugee & Immigrant Community Services (RICS) provides on-site English language and English language civics classes for adult immigrants from over 20 countries.

We are looking for an intern to serve in our English Language Training (ELT) Program.

Responsibilities of this position include:

  • Assisting teachers in English as a Second Language (ESL) and English Language Civics classes, including tutoring and/or teaching classes
  • Creating and implementing workshops and activities for our students
  • Helping with other projects, reports, and administrative tasks as necessary
  • Minimum of 10 hours per week availability, minimum two-month commitment

Reports to: Supervisor of English Language Training

Qualifications:

  • Must be at least 18 years of age
  • Interest in working with immigrants in a multi-cultural, multi-lingual, and multi-ethnic environment
  • Excellent communication and organizational skills
  • Patience and flexibility
  • Computer proficiency
  • Some knowledge of ESL and teaching or tutoring experience is helpful
  • Language proficiency in one or more: Arabic, Polish, Russian, Spanish, and Ukrainian is preferred, but not required.
